Long-Term Results of Three Cases of Radial Keratotomy
Journal of the Korean Ophthalmological Society ; : 124-126, 2015.
Article Dans Coréen | WPRIM | ID: wpr-45172
ABSTRACT

PURPOSE:

To report the long-term results concerning refractive changes after radial keratotomy in 6 eyes of 3 patients. CASE

SUMMARY:

We observed 3 patients who underwent radial keratotomy over 25 years previously. The positive effect of this surgery on the correction of refractive error decreased with increasing post-surgery time and myopic refractive errors accompanying astigmatism recurred. On average, refractive errors improved to 3.375 diopter (D) and corneal power improved to 2.954 D; in all cases, uncorrected visual acuities were not significantly improved.

CONCLUSIONS:

The effect of radial keratotomy on the correction of refractive errors decreased with time due to regression; myopic refractive errors recurred in the long-term.
